Combine the like terms to create an equivalent expression:
\large{4z-(-3z)}

To combine like terms, we need to perform the operation indicated by the subtraction sign. In this case, we need to distribute the negative sign to the terms inside the parentheses:
\begin{align*}
4z - (-3z) &= 4z + 3z
\end{align*}
Now, we can combine the like terms by adding the coefficients:
\begin{align*}
4z + 3z &= \boxed{7z}
\end{align*}
So, the equivalent expression is \boxed{7z}.
